Exporting kitchenware successfully requires a thorough understanding of the B2B market dynamics. Knowing your audience and the competitive landscape is the first step.
Before entering a new market, conduct in-depth research to understand consumer preferences, pricing structures, and regulatory requirements. Tailoring your approach to specific markets increases the chances of success.
Forming strategic partnerships with local distributors can enhance your market entry. These partners often have invaluable knowledge about local customs and consumer behavior.
Maintaining high-quality standards is essential in the kitchenware industry. Implement strict quality control measures to ensure that your products meet international standards, thus reducing returns and increasing customer satisfaction.
A strong online presence is crucial for B2B kitchenware exporters. Utilize SEO strategies, social media marketing, and online trade shows to reach potential clients globally.
Keep abreast of industry news, trends, and emerging technologies. This will enable you to remain competitive and adapt your strategies as necessary.
By applying these tips and remaining flexible, kitchenware exporters can increase their chances of success in the dynamic B2B market.
